The Register of Locally Owned Businesses
A hand-vetted register of locally owned businesses across Saint George and Southern Utah. Built for people who want a cleaner signal than review noise, paid rankings, and scraped directories.
435 Alliance is being built as a local register: clear business identity, practical categories, local context, and enough editorial care that a customer can understand who they are looking at.
The first version starts with trust-heavy trades and local services. Restaurants with a 702 connection, including Mint Indian Bistro and Meraki Greek Grill, are priority targets for proving the multi-market Alliance model.
The public internet can give us candidates, but the register is not a dump of scraped listings. A real entry needs local context, a reason to belong, and a path to verification.
Every profile is written as an editorial record. Names, phones, websites, locations, ownership claims, and licenses get checked before a draft becomes a verified member page.
A register you can hold in your head is worth more than a directory you have to search. The ceiling is four hundred thirty-five, matching the area code on purpose.

435 Alliance is the first expansion market. The working register is larger than the verified member base because we are building the candidate map first, then tightening the public trust layer one business at a time.
No paid placement. No rankings for dollars. A clean register for the people other people here actually call.
The listed profile is free. The optional verified setup helps install the badge and structured identity layer so customers, Google, and AI systems can understand the connection clearly.
